SAM BALL

We like this release from Sam Ball, but what we really like and want is the bumping tunes from record label Intec. Intec records was founded by Carl Cox and Safehouse Management. If you want to hear some movin' & grovin' tech house tunes, this is the label to check out! With featured track from Yousef, Jon Rundell, Cristian Varela, Sebastien Leger, and Carl Cox himself... This one is well worth scoping out with the many other artist signed!
